
BurgerTime
An arcade-style action game where players control chef Peter Pepper who must assemble giant burgers while avoiding food enemies like Mr. Hot Dog and Mr. Egg.

About This Retro Game
Originally released in arcades in 1982 before being ported to NES, featuring innovative gameplay where players walk over burger ingredients to drop them down platforms.
Strategic elements include using pepper to temporarily stun enemies and triggering cascading ingredient drops for bonus points.
Known for its charming food-themed characters and increasing difficulty as players progress through the burger assembly stages.
